how do erosion and deposition work together to form sand dunes?\nwaves cause erosion along coastlines and deposit sand away from the shore.\nerosion occurs as surface water carries sediment and the sediment is deposited near oceans and lakes.\nglaciers cause erosion through the movement of large chunks of ice, which are deposited and form depressions.\nerosion occurs through deflation, and sand that was picked up is deposited against an obstruction.

Answer

Answer:

D. Erosion occurs through deflation, and sand that was picked up is deposited against an obstruction.

Brief Explanations:

Sand dunes form when wind (deflation - a type of erosion) picks up sand and deposits it when it meets an obstacle. Options A and B describe processes related to water - not the typical formation of sand dunes. Option C is about glaciers and formation of depressions, not sand dunes.
